27-04-08 / 22:50 : Copyright and use of sound libraries (cjed) | Through this study document, La protection et l’exploitation des
banques de sons instrumentales, the author deals with the various kings of sound synthesis, evolving of sounds libraries, and copyrighting (also use licences). He mentions the creative commons licence and those products : VSL, Colossus, Synful Orchestra. For example, when using a loop from these libraries (rare - but some drums loops from Artist Grooves can sometimes be incredibly useful) the Soundsonline licence states :
(1) Loops must be used in a musical context with at least two other instruments that contribute significantly to the composition.
(2) The entire loop cannot be left exposed at any time in the composition.
